Community Service Officer (CSO)
The City of Wheaton Police Department is hiring a full-time Community Service Officer to join our team. The CSO is a civilian, uniformed position that works under the general direction of the Shift Commander and provides community service to citizens for, generally, non-emergency situations. Additionally, this role is responsible for enforcing parking ordinances, assisting with animal control and other non-criminal related offenses that support the Patrol Department. This individual must be able to exercise sound judgement under stress as the work is primarily done independently.
Duties and Responsibilities
Essential duties and responsibilities include, but are not limited to, the following:
- Assist residents and community members with non-emergency aid such as lockouts, vacant house checks, wild or domestic animal complaints, down wire calls, water main breaks, street defects/obstructions, etc.
- Enforce various parking regulations by on-foot patrol of all City parking zones, lots and garages that are timed-control and/or paid - including chalking tires in metered areas, issuing tickets and handling parking complaints from residents and businesses.
- Assist motorists with various situations such as stalled cars and towing, provide transportation when appropriate.
- Remove roadway hazards and control and direct vehicular and pedestrian traffic using barriers, flares and hand signals.
- Enforce City regulations and ordinances and, when necessary, issue tickets regarding non-criminal violations such as watering, open burn, bicycle, signage, leaves/grass, etc.
- Assist Police Officers in prisoner searches, locating missing children or adults, roadside child safety seat compliance checks, and investigating traffic accidents and private property damage.
- Pick up and deliver confidential records, reports, paperwork and large sums of petty cash and property at various locations throughout the City.
- Prepare reports related to found property, improperly stored autos, accident reports, animal bites, etc. as assigned.
- Serve as backup for department civilian personnel, including assisting with Evidence Control duties and filling in for School Crossing Guards when assigned.
